Course programme

The course involves an interview to select the most appropriate qualification units for you and to determine that the units and qualification level are achievable. The NVQ is assessed in the workplace and the candidate is observed performing the criteria laid down in the chosen units. Underpinning knowledge questions for those units are answered, satisfactorily completed. The qualification is gained by being observed satisfactorily performing the unit performance criteria and satisfactorily answering the underpinning knowledge questions. A portfolio of evidence is built to the satisfaction of the allotted assessor. The applicant should be competent in the chosen units and will be tutored to fulfil the requirements of the observation and underpinning knowledge assessments. A team of dedicated assessors will visit students in the workplace to ascertain technical and occupational competence in Mechanical Manufacturing Engineering. This is an assessed qualification and so no skills are taught.Once you have enrolled onto the programme you will be assigned an assessor that will visit you in the workplace regularly. They will complete assessment plans and reviews with you to keep you on target. They will support you in the collection of the required evidence needed for your qualification through different assessment methods such as; professional discussion, observations, written questions, verbal questions, witness statements and any assignments.
